Transaction 54bdb8601aafe74555391df012bf3b5bf00d77effe260d0e98fc95bc4cbb9bcd
1 Input
1 Output
-
54bdb8601aafe74555391df012bf3b5bf00d77effe260d0e98fc95bc4cbb9bcd:0
- value
- 28696314
- script pubkey
- OP_0 OP_PUSHBYTES_20 e071a60e72d8528377e3a2340dc2d48e3fa7e072
- address
- bc1qupc6vrnjmpfgxalr5g6qmsk53cl60crjdsfyu5